
A Comprehensive Guide to Theory and Implementation. Bridging the gap between theory and practice with this extensive guide to neural networks, featuring parallel implementations in both Python and MATLAB. Navigating the complex landscape of neural networks requires not only a firm grasp of theoretical foundations but also the practical skills to implement them effectively. Practical Neural Networks in Python and MATLAB is designed to be a definitive resource, offering a unique dual-language approach to mastering these powerful models. Key Features: A Dual-Language, Integrated Approach: This book provides a side-by-side exploration of neural networks in both Python and MATLAB. This methodology allows you to leverage Python's rich deep learning ecosystem (TensorFlow, Keras, PyTorch) and MATLAB's specialized toolboxes, giving you the flexibility to work within your preferred environment or across different project requirements. Comprehensive Coverage of Algorithms and Architectures: Move beyond basic backpropagation. The text provides a systematic review of fundamental and advanced training algorithms, including Gradient Descent, Newton's Method, Levenberg-Marquardt, Recursive Least Squares (RLS), and metaheuristics like Genetic Algorithms and Particle Swarm Optimization. Furthermore, it offers a detailed survey of over 25 major neural network architectures, from foundational Perceptrons and Feedforward Networks to advanced systems like CNNs, RNNs (LSTM, GRU), Autoencoders, GANs, and Deep Belief Networks. Practical, Code-Oriented Learning: Each concept and architecture is accompanied by ready-to-run code examples. This practical focus ensures that you can immediately translate theoretical understanding into functional code, experiment with parameters, and adapt the implementations to your own unique challenges. Real-World Application and Case Studies: The learning is grounded in practicality through divers
Page Count:
146
Publication Date:
2026-02-18
ISBN-10:
303214745X
ISBN-13:
9783032147455
No comments yet. Be the first to share your thoughts!